The word bed frame, which is also called a bedstead, is the part of the bed that supports its base and shows its position. The bed base is normally the flat part that directly supports the mattress. The word “bed frame” was first used between 1805 and 1815. In recent years, many changes have been seen in bedroom interiors. A bed frame not only provides support but also strengthens the structure.

Choosing the Right Upholstered Bed for Your Space
If you also want to decorate and style your bedroom, then you should know a few important things. Every bedroom has a different size, design, and interior, so you should select your bed accordingly. If the bedroom space is small and you bring a large bed there, then it will create problems for you. You may not even be able to walk there. There should be at least 24–30 inches of walkway space in the bedroom.
Best Colors and Fabrics for Upholstered Beds
We already explained above that upholstered bed frames are available in different colors and beautiful fabrics, which is why many people want to decorate their bedroom. If you select colors and fabric properly, it also helps a lot in decorating your bedroom and makes it more stylish, cozy, and modern. But nowadays, neutral colors like grey, beige, cream, and white upholstered beds are very trendy. One special reason for this is that they easily match with every bedroom interior. Along with this, if you use blue, black, and dark green, they provide a luxurious, premium feel.
If we talk about fabrics, then velvet upholstered beds give the softest and most luxurious feel because their smooth texture not only makes the bedroom beautiful but also classy and attractive. But if we talk about linen fabric beds, then these beds are best for a simple and modern look, while leather upholstered beds provide a durable and sophisticated style, and their look is also beautiful.

Upholstered Beds vs Wooden Beds: At a Glance
| Wooden Beds | Upholstered Beds |
| Provide timeless and classic style | Give a modern and stylish look |
| Easy to clean | Cleaning is possible but slightly difficult |
| Very sturdy and durable | Soft and comfortable |
| Because of heavy wooden parts, assembling can be difficult | Normally easy to assemble |
| Mostly cheaper than fabric bed frames | Affordable but can be slightly more expensive than wooden beds |
| Weight is more | These can also be heavy |
| Have hard wooden frame | Have soft fabric and foam finish |
| Best for traditional and simple decor | Perfect for modern and luxury bedrooms |
Tips to Maintain an Upholstered Bed Frame
In today’s fast world, if you want your upholstered bed frame to remain stylish and comfortable for a longer time, then you will have to take proper care of it, which means maintenance should continue regularly. Because of soft fabric and foam, upholstered bed frames need more cleaning compared to wooden beds.
Dust and dirt quickly collect on the fabric, so you should clean it with a vacuum cleaner or soft brush. Along with this, you should protect it from direct sunlight because sunlight can damage the fabric color. You should also protect the fabric from water. You should rotate the mattress on time and also check the screws. With proper care, upholstered bed frames stay useful for a long time.
